Pulse Feedback is an AI-powered employee feedback platform that combines pulse surveys, 360-degree feedback, and AI-guided analysis tools to help HR teams collect and interpret employee sentiment across their organization.

Who Is Pulse Feedback Best For?

Pulse Feedback is a good fit for HR teams in mid-sized organizations that need a structured, multilingual approach to running employee surveys across distributed or international workforces.

Why I Picked Pulse Feedback

I've included Pulse Feedback in my top picks because its multilingual survey support goes well beyond basic translation. The platform lets participants take surveys and interact with results in English, German, French, and Italian, and the comment translation feature automatically converts open-text responses into each participant's preferred language. That's especially useful when running feedback cycles across international offices, where language barriers can otherwise suppress honest, high-quality responses.

How I Evaluate AI Employee Feedback Software

I evaluate whether the AI delivers value you'd never get manually—like detecting attrition signals in verbatims or turning raw feedback into manager coaching. I split my evaluation into two layers: the core functionality needed to make the list and the differentiators that separate one vendor from another.

Core Functionality (Table Stakes For This List)

When I'm selecting tools for my list, I rank each one on a scale from 0 (does not offer the functionality) to 5 (excels in this area) for each core functionality listed below. Then, I calculate the tool's total score into a percentage. Each tool needs to achieve a minimum total score of 65% to be considered for inclusion.

  • AI-Powered Sentiment Analysis: I look for NLP that reads emotion and tone in open-ended responses, not just positive/negative keyword matching on structured answers.
  • Automated Pulse Surveys: The tool should deploy recurring check-ins and eNPS at configurable cadences, ideally with AI-optimized question selection by audience segment.
  • Theme & Topic Detection: Manually tagging thousands of verbatims is a dealbreaker. I evaluate how well the AI clusters and summarizes qualitative feedback into actionable themes.
  • Predictive People Analytics: Strong tools surface attrition risk and engagement drivers from feedback patterns, giving HR a forward-looking view rather than a rear-view mirror.
  • AI Action Recommendations: I check whether the platform generates specific, role-aware next steps for managers based on their team's results rather than generic advice.
  • Anonymity & Confidentiality Controls: Respondent trust depends on this. I look for configurable thresholds, AI-driven PII redaction, and safeguards that prevent re-identification in small teams.

Once I have a list of tools that meet this criteria, I consider what sets each platform apart.

Differentiating Factors (What Sets Vendors Apart)

Here's how I compare and contrast different vendors:

Standout Features

Generative AI reporting stands out. The best tools turn weeks of analysis into one-click executive summaries HR leaders can share with the C-suite right after a survey closes. I also evaluate whether a platform includes a manager coaching copilot that drafts 1:1 talking points from team results, helping managers act on feedback rather than ignore it. For global organizations, multilingual NLP matters. I check whether sentiment and theme detection work natively across languages instead of relying on translation layers that strip cultural nuance.

Beyond Features

Data privacy and AI governance top my list. Employee feedback is sensitive, so I check for SOC 2 Type II compliance, regional data residency options, and transparent AI bias auditing. HRIS integration depth matters too—tools that sync with Workday or BambooHR can auto-trigger surveys at key lifecycle moments without manual setup. I also evaluate benchmarking access, since cross-industry engagement benchmarks help HR leaders contextualize their scores and build a stronger case for action with leadership.

What Is AI Employee Feedback Software?

AI employee feedback software is a tool that leverages artificial intelligence to gather, analyze, and interpret employee feedback. HR professionals and team leaders use these tools to enhance engagement and improve workplace culture. Sentiment analysis, predictive insights, and real-time data processing help understand employee sentiment and make informed decisions. Overall, these tools provide value by offering actionable insights to foster a more positive work environment.

Features

When selecting AI employee feedback software, keep an eye out for the following key features:

  • Sentiment analysis: Analyzes text feedback to determine emotional tone, helping you understand employee feelings and concerns.
  • Predictive insights: Uses AI to forecast trends and potential issues, allowing proactive management of employee engagement.
  • Real-time data processing: Provides immediate analysis of feedback, enabling swift action on employee sentiments and suggestions.
  • Customizable dashboards: Offers tailored views of data, letting you focus on specific metrics and insights relevant to your organization.
  • Natural language processing: Interprets and categorizes feedback from open-ended responses, making it easier to identify key themes.
  • Integration capabilities: Connects with existing HR systems to simplify data flow and provide a holistic view of employee feedback.
  • Interactive reports: Generates visual representations of data, aiding in the clear communication of insights to stakeholders.
  • Continuous feedback loops: Facilitates ongoing dialogue between employees and management, promoting a culture of openness and improvement.
  • Multilingual support: Analyzes feedback in multiple languages, ensuring inclusivity in diverse workplaces.
  • Automated alerts: Notifies you of significant changes in feedback trends, helping prioritize urgent issues.

AI Employee Feedback Software FAQs

Here are some answers to common questions about AI employee feedback software:

How do I ensure data security with AI feedback tools?

Look for AI feedback tools that support encryption, regular data backups, and compliance with data-protection regulations like GDPR. Since these platforms often store sensitive information tied to employee development and learning experiences, strong safeguards are essential. Ask vendors whether they offer breach-notification processes and how they secure machine learning models that analyze employee responses. Enable two-factor authentication, restrict access to authorized HR team members, and keep the software up to date to prevent vulnerabilities.

Can AI tools integrate with existing HR systems?

Yes, many AI feedback tools integrate with HR platforms such as Workday, BambooHR, and SAP SuccessFactors. This allows feedback data to sit alongside development plans, learning paths, or employee training records in your HR ecosystem. Ask vendors for examples of successful integrations and whether the connection requires technical setup. A demo can help you understand how feedback insights inform broader data-driven decisions across your HR workflows.

What kind of support can I expect from vendors?

Support varies by provider, but most offer email and phone assistance, with some providing live chat or dedicated account managers. Check whether they offer onboarding help, beneficial when setting up LMS integrations, configuring feedback cycles, or connecting the tool to training systems. Look into their knowledge base, support hours, and customer reviews to gauge reliability.

How does AI employee feedback software improve the quality of feedback?

AI feedback tools use machine learning to analyze employee responses in real time, identifying patterns, sentiment, and emerging issues. This leads to more accurate, actionable insights and helps you detect skill gaps or upskilling opportunities. Many platforms also streamline survey creation, increasing participation and improving the quality of your learning experiences and internal communication.

Can I trust AI tools to keep employee feedback anonymous?

Yes, most AI employee feedback tools are designed to protect anonymity by separating identities from response data. They often group feedback into trends or categories, helpful for leaders tracking progress across employee training or team development, without exposing individual responses. Reviewing the vendor’s privacy documentation can give you added confidence.
